New to writing and i cringe at everything i write at by Important-Engine-574 in Songwriting

[–]No-Awareness -1 points0 points  (0 children)

I have this exact experience, luckily when the distance from you separates (I.E when you are no longer in the creative process and it's finished and no longer active), for me I find myself genuinely loving stuff I've written. It's for you nobody else. Let it be 'cringe', because that's what makes it human.

Another tip: once it's written and done, don't listen to it too much, just mindlessly release it if the option is available. Don't dwell on it, because you will only see it with the bias of being the one that wrote it.

Danger in writing negative songs by smartalek22 in Songwriting

[–]No-Awareness 0 points1 point  (0 children)

I've had these same thoughts a lot actually. It feels very forced to write about positivity but the lyrics about negativity can pull me down. I found a good medium in trying to write about the world rather than about myself, that way it doesn't have to be about pulling myself down. Even neutral observations I feel are valid and might help you in not kind of nasal gazing.
